WebJan 31, 2024 · Make your candles with soy wax flakes, which are environmentally friendly and easy to work with. Wash your glasses and glue a wick to the bottom to prep them for candle-making. Heat the wax to about 185 °F (85 °C), then let it cool to about 120 °F (49 °C) before you add fragrance oils or essential oils for the scent. WebCandle Science. There’s a lot of chemistry and physics behind the beauty and light of a candle flame. In fact, scientists have been fascinated by candles for hundreds of years. In 1860, Michael Faraday gave his now-famous lecture series on the Chemical History of a Candle, demonstrating dozens of scientific principles through his careful ... WebMay 18, 2024 · Heat the candle with a blow dryer to even out the surface. Set your blow dryer to low heat, then point the nozzle at the candle. Focus mainly on the areas where the wax is the highest, pouring off excess wax as it accumulates on the surface of the candle.
